Redmine, açık kaynaklı bir proje yönetim yazılımıdır ve birçok işletme tarafından tercih edilmektedir. Redmine, proje yönetimi, zaman takibi, kaynak planlaması, iş takibi, belge yönetimi, ekip işbirliği ve raporlama gibi birçok özelliği içerisinde barındıran bir yazılımdır. Redmine’in bu özellikleri sayesinde, birçok işletme proje yönetimi işlemlerini daha etkin ve verimli bir şekilde gerçekleştirebilmektedir.
Bu belge, LiteSpeed sunucusu kullanarak Redmine’in nasıl kurulacağına dair adımları içermektedir. LiteSpeed sunucusu, yüksek performanslı bir web sunucusu olup, PHP, Ruby, Python ve diğer birçok programlama dili için destek sağlamaktadır. LiteSpeed sunucusu, Apache sunucusuna kıyasla daha hızlı ve daha az kaynak tüketen bir sunucudur. Bu nedenle, Redmine kurulumu için LiteSpeed sunucusunun kullanılması önerilmektedir.
Adım 1: LiteSpeed Sunucusu Kurulumu
LiteSpeed sunucusunu kurmak oldukça kolaydır. Aşağıdaki adımları takip ederek kurulum işlemini gerçekleştirebilirsiniz:
- LiteSpeed web sitesinden LiteSpeed sunucusunu indirin. İndirme işlemi, internet bağlantınızın hızına bağlı olarak birkaç dakika sürebilir.
- İndirilen dosyayı açın ve kurulum sihirbazını başlatın.
- Kurulum sihirbazındaki adımları takip edin ve kurulumu tamamlayın.
Adım 2: Redmine Kurulumu
Redmine kurulumu, birkaç adımda gerçekleştirilebilir. Aşağıdaki adımları takip ederek Redmine’i kurabilirsiniz:
- Redmine web sitesinden en son sürümünü indirin. Bu adımı gerçekleştirdikten sonra, dosyaları bir klasöre çıkarın.
- LiteSpeed sunucusundaki “suexec” özelliğini etkinleştirin. Bu adım, Redmine’in doğru şekilde çalışabilmesi için oldukça önemlidir.
- Redmine klasörünü sunucunun kök dizinine kopyalayın. Bu adım, Redmine’in sunucunun kök dizinine doğru şekilde yerleştirilmesini sağlayacaktır.
- Redmine klasöründe bulunan “config” klasöründeki “database.yml.example” dosyasını “database.yml” olarak kopyalayın ve açın. Bu adım, veritabanı bilgilerinin doğru şekilde girilmesini sağlayacaktır.
- Veritabanı bilgilerinizi (veritabanı adı, kullanıcı adı ve şifre) “database.yml” dosyasına ekleyin.
- LiteSpeed sunucusunda “Ruby on Rails” özelliğini etkinleştirin. Bu adım, Redmine’in doğru şekilde çalışabilmesi için gereklidir.
- Redmine klasöründe komut satırını açın ve aşağıdaki komutu çalıştırın:
bundle install --without development test
- Aynı komut satırında aşağıdaki komutu çalıştırın:
rake generate_secret_token
- Aynı komut satırında aşağıdaki komutu çalıştırın:
RAILS_ENV=production rake db:migrate
- Redmine klasöründeki “public” klasöründeki “.htaccess” dosyasını açın ve aşağıdaki satırları ekleyin:
RewriteEngine On RewriteRule ^$ /redmine [R=301,L]
- Tarayıcınızda “http://localhost/redmine” adresine gidin ve Redmine’in yüklendiğini gözlemleyin.
Bu adımları takip ederek, LiteSpeed sunucusunda Redmine’in kurulumunu tamamlamış olacaksınız. Kurulum işlemi tamamlandıktan sonra, Redmine üzerinden projelerinizi kolayca yönetebilirsiniz. Redmine, kullanımı kolay bir arayüze sahiptir ve birçok özelliği içinde barındırdığı için, işletmelerin proje yönetim işlemlerini kolayca gerçekleştirmesine olanak sağlamaktadır.
Redmine, açık kaynaklı bir yazılım olduğundan, kullanıcılar tarafından sürekli olarak geliştirilmekte ve güncellenmektedir. Bu nedenle, Redmine kurulumundan sonra düzenli olarak güncellenmesi önerilmektedir. Bu sayede, güncellemeleri takip ederek, Redmine’in daha güvenli ve daha verimli bir şekilde kullanımı mümkün olacaktır.
Redmine, birçok eklenti desteği sunmaktadır. Bu eklentiler sayesinde, Redmine’in özellikleri daha da genişletilebilmektedir. Örneğin, “Agile” eklentisi ile Redmine üzerinden Agile proje yönetimi işlemleri gerçekleştirilebilmektedir. “Git” eklentisi ile Redmine üzerinden Git projeleri yönetilebilmektedir. Bu eklentilerden faydalanarak, Redmine’in özelliklerini daha da genişletebilirsiniz.
Sonuç olarak, LiteSpeed sunucusu kullanarak Redmine’in kurulumu oldukça kolaydır. Redmine, birçok özelliği içerisinde barındıran bir yazılım olduğundan, işletmelerin proje yönetim işlemlerini kolayca gerçekleştirebilirler. Redmine, açık kaynaklı bir yazılım olduğundan, düzenli olarak güncellenmesi önerilmektedir. Ayrıca, Redmine’in özellikleri eklentiler sayesinde daha da genişletilebilmektedir.